This document provides background information and objectives for an expert survey on Insurtech that is being conducted as part of a master's thesis. The survey aims to reveal different characteristics of Insurtech in a holistic way and understand its role in the insurance ecosystem. It will examine business models, success factors, image, trends, market forces, macroeconomic forces and industry forces influencing Insurtech. The interviews will follow academic standards and provide anonymity while benefiting participants with a analysis of results and copy of the thesis. The survey seeks experts from Insurtech companies, insurers, incubators, investors and other relevant fields.

3. The insurance industry faces numerous challenges from the digitale context.
New technologies lead to a digital transformation in economy and society.
3
Digital Insurance Sector Forces
Suppliers
§ Conversion of existing
direct sales channels
§ Start-ups development
throughout incubators and
accelerators
Substitutes
§ Damag- reducing technologies,
such as autonomous cars
New Entrants
§ Insurtech start-ups
§ International IT-giants
§ Comparison portals
Expert Survey Insurtech 2016
€
Buyers
§ High aspiration levels on
digital service quality
§ Development of new needs and
wishes from digital lifestyles
§ Moral hazard incenttives from
trust deficitis to corporate groups
§ Ropo-effect behaviour in sales
Rivalry
§ Little consolidation of incumbents
§ Market saturation in Germany
§ Growth of direct sales numbers
§ Regulation as from Solvency II
§ Low-interest environment
